A Bug In the Bed

A bug in the bed, Is a disaster, It will make your bed Hell for you, You twist and twirl, You rock and roll, You scratch and scratch, You search and search, It will hide itself, In the folds and nooks, Creating the hell for you, You will not have a wink, Of sleep, Until you find it under, Your shirt pinned to your chest, Inflated with your blood, You will have to crush it , With your all might, Until your blood spills out, And there in lies your instant relief!!
